Chronicles of Sal Rei

Sal Rei was founded in the 18th century as a port for the island of Boa Vista's salt trade, which gave the town its name (Sal Rei means 'Salt King'). The original colonial grid of dusty streets and low, pastel-painted houses remains largely intact, although newer concrete buildings have crept in. Culturally, Sal Rei is the island's commercial and administrative hub, but it still feels like a fishing town: daily catches are sold on the beach near the fish market, and the pace of life is dictated by the trades winds. Contemporary identity is a relaxed blend of Portuguese colonial legacy, African rhythms, and the growing vibe of expats and kitesurfers.

Best Time to Visit

Full Sal Rei guide →

Best months

December to April – dry, sunny, and the trades winds are strong enough for kitesurfing but not too gusty. Temperatures sit around 24-27°C.

Peak / festival surge

July and August – European summer holidays fill flights and hotels; prices at Cale Da Lua can double. The heat peaks (28-31°C) and the winds drop, so it's quieter for water sports but busy on the beaches.

Budget shoulder season

May and June – still dry and warm, crowds thin out, and hotel rates drop. November is also good, with the rains just ending and fewer tourists.

Weather & packing

Cabo Verde has a dry tropical climate with almost no rain between November and June, but the trade winds can kick up dust from the Sahara in January and February. Pack a lightweight windbreaker for evenings and a sturdy pair of reef sandals – the beaches are coral-strewn and the sand can be hot.

Money & Currency

Get a travel card →
💵
Local currency

Cape Verdean Escudo, CVE

🏦
Where to exchange

Change money at banks or official exchange bureaux in Sal Rei; avoid the airport where rates are poor and tourist bureaux often give worse rates.

💳
Cards & contactless

Cards are accepted in most hotels and larger restaurants, but many smaller shops, taxis, and market stalls only take cash; contactless is rare.

🪙
Tipping etiquette

Round up taxi fares or leave 5-10% in restaurants if service is good; hotel staff appreciate 100-200 CVE per bag or per day for housekeeping.

Eat, Shop & Travel on a Budget

Cheap car hire →
Cheap coffee

A small black coffee (bica) at a local bar or pastelaria costs about 40-60 CVE.

🥪
Best-value lunch

A grilled fish or chicken with rice and salad at a local eatery (not a tourist spot) costs roughly 500-700 CVE.

🍝
Affordable dinner

A main dish at a modest restaurant, like cachupa or grilled fish, costs around 700-900 CVE.

🌮
Street food & cheap eats

The main beachfront promenade and the market area near the port have small stalls selling pastéis (fried pastries) and grilled corn, especially in the evening.

🛒
Budget groceries

Supermercado Tavares and Supermercado Patativa are common budget supermarkets in Sal Rei.

👕
Affordable clothes

Small clothing stalls at the municipal market offer affordable, basic items; for better variety, shop in Espargos on Sal island.

🎫
Cheapest way around

The cheapest way around town is walking; for longer trips, share a 'aluguer' (shared minibus) for 50-80 CVE per ride, or negotiate a taxi from the airport (expect 500-800 CVE to central Sal Rei).

💡
Money-saving tips

Eat where locals eat, order the catch of the day rather than imported meat, and buy bottled water in bulk at supermarkets rather than from tourist shops.
